Poison Oak Removal in Bel Air, MD
Poison oak removal services focus on safely eliminating this common and potentially irritating plant from residential properties. These services typically cover a variety of projects, including clearing poison oak from yards, gardens, wooded areas, and other outdoor spaces. Property owners often request this service to reduce the risk of skin irritation for family members, pets, and visitors, especially in areas where the plant has become invasive or dense. Proper removal helps maintain a safe outdoor environment and prevents the spread of poison oak to other parts of the property.
Before requesting poison oak removal, property owners should consider the extent of the infestation and the location of the plants in relation to structures, play areas, or gardens. It’s important to understand that poison oak can be difficult to identify for those unfamiliar with it, and proper removal often requires protective equipment and techniques to ensure safety. Clarifying the scope of the project and any specific concerns about nearby plants or sensitive areas can help ensure the removal process is thorough and effective.

Poison Oak Removal Questions
What is poison oak removal? Poison oak removal involves safely eliminating the plant to prevent skin irritation and allergic reactions on a property.
When should poison oak be removed? Removal is recommended when poison oak is growing in high-traffic areas or near recreational spaces to reduce exposure risks.
What areas are typically targeted for poison oak removal? Common areas include yards, trails, fences, and around landscape features where the plant has established.
Is poison oak removal safe for the landscape? Yes, professional removal methods aim to eliminate the plant while minimizing impact on surrounding vegetation.
